Abstract In this thesis, the syntheses of chiral ferrocenylimines and their cyclomercuration, cyclopaliadation were studied in the following three aspects: 1. Ferrocenylimines (+)-(R)-2 and (-)-(S)-2 were prepared by the condensation of benzoylferrocene with R-(+)-cL-phenyl-ethylamine [(+}-(R)-l] and S-(-)-phenyl-ethylamine((-)-(S)-l], respectively, in the presence of freshly activated A1203. The products (+)-(R)-2 and (-)-{S)-2 were characterized by elemental analyses, IR and 慔 NMR spectra. Ph (+)-(R)-1 Ph AI~Q Qj Ph (-).(S)-1 H 2. Cyclomercuration of (+)-(R)-2 and (-)-(S)-2 with mercuric acetate and subsequent treatment with lithium chloride at room temperature gave two pairs of diastereomers, respectively. Cyclopalladation of (+)-(R)-2 and (-)-(S)-2 with Li2PdCL~ in the presence of sodium abetate and subsequent treatment with PPh3 gave two pairs of diastereomers, respectively. The four enantiopure compounds: (+) -(Rp,Rc)-4, (-) -(Sp,Rc)-4, (+) -(Rp,Sc)-4, (-) -(Sp,Sc)-4 were isolated from the two mixtures by silica gel plate. All of the compounds 3 were characterized by elemental analyses, IR and 慔 NMR spectra. The structure and absolute configurations of the four diastereomers of compounds 4 were determined by x-ray diffraction or characterized by CD spectra.
